Transaction 5113d1afb0b8d0ca80803ca4ce2fe8d93e8174038d89122010594a538f15be16
1 Input
2 Outputs
- 5113d1afb0b8d0ca80803ca4ce2fe8d93e8174038d89122010594a538f15be16:0
- 5113d1afb0b8d0ca80803ca4ce2fe8d93e8174038d89122010594a538f15be16:1
value 8976800
address 143oPeDtdX41KAwcpX4T2WxrMSbb3tewSU
value 59754692
address 1NjZ3Xt6h2Ee5fYzaF4iyWWRZpUzh2MCRi